What’s the role? This role is part of our Mob Way program, a culturally grounded pathway unlocking senior opportunities for Aboriginal and Torres Strait Islander leaders. As a Lead Business Analyst, you will lead business and data analysis activities across strategic initiatives, driving high‑quality, scalable, and compliant solutions. Acting as a bridge between business and technology, you will ensure requirements are clearly defined, solutions align to business objectives, and delivery outcomes meet enterprise standards. You will provide strong leadership across initiatives while promoting consistent analysis practices and supporting effective execution. Additionally, you'll mentor senior and junior business analysts, conduct peer reviews of analysis artefacts, and define best‑practice frameworks to ensure quality and consistency. You will partner closely with architects, engineers, and stakeholders to shape solution design, translate requirements into user stories, process flows, and data mappings, and validate solutions to ensure they are fit for purpose. You will engage stakeholders across business and technology, support data analysis, migration, and governance initiatives, and contribute to delivery, risk, regulatory, and governance reporting within Agile or hybrid environments Through Mob Way, you will be supported to grow your career while staying connected to culture. This includes strong executive connection, opportunities to build your networks, and dedicated time for in‑community experiences and elder‑led cultural immersion. What do I need? * Previous experience as a senior or lead business analyst  * Solid understanding of data migration, transformation, governance, and data quality principles * Strong stakeholder engagement, analytical, and problem‑solving skills, with the ability to translate technical concepts into clear business language * Strong working knowledge of SQL and data querying concepts, with the ability to read, interpret, and validate queries * Experience with enterprise data platforms and reporting tools such as Teradata and Power BI * Experience working within Agile delivery environments, supporting structured documentation and high attention to detail Why join us?
